Filter By
Olive Tree
Palm Trees
Mediterranean Plants
Trees & Fruit Trees
Promotions
There are 1827 products.
sortSort by:
ONT80 - L0152/2
ONT80 - L0152/3
ONT80 - L0153/3
ONT80 - L0153/4
ONT80 - L0153/5
OPC100 - H01031
OPC100 - H01038
OPC30 - L11086
OPC30 - L11166
OPC40 - L0133/5
OPC40 - L0135/4
OPC40 - L0135/5
OPC40 - L0136/2
OPC40 - L0136/3
OPC40 - L0137/2
check_circle